*** 作方法如下:
1、下载可安装的EclipseSQLiteManger插件,官网:>
使用Java提供的JDBC技术
附上一段常用的JDBC连接MySQL的代码
package DAO;
import javasqlConnection;
import javasqlDriverManager;
import javasqlSQLException;
public class JDBC {
private static final String DRIVERCLASS = "commysqljdbcDriver";
// private static final String URL = "jdbc:mysql://localhost:3306/javademo";
// private static final String USERNAME = "root";
// private static final String PASSWORD = "";
private static final String url ="jdbc:mysql://localhost:3306/EIMS"
+ "user=root&password=&useUnicode=true&characterEncoding=UTF8";
//通过useUnicode=true&characterEncoding=UTF8 避免中文字符乱码
private static final ThreadLocal<Connection> threadLocal = new ThreadLocal<Connection>();
static {// 通过静态方法加载数据库驱动
try {
ClassforName(DRIVERCLASS);// 加载数据库驱动
Systemoutprintln("成功加载MySQL驱动程序");
} catch (Exception e) {
eprintStackTrace();
}
}
public static Connection getConnection() {// 创建数据库连接的方法
Connection conn = threadLocalget();// 从线程中获得数据库连接
if (conn == null) {// 没有可用的数据库连接
try {
// conn = DriverManagergetConnection(URL, USERNAME, PASSWORD);// 创建新的数据库连接
conn = DriverManagergetConnection(url);
threadLocalset(conn);// 将数据库连接保存到线程中
Systemoutprintln("创建数据库连接成功!!");
} catch (SQLException e) {
eprintStackTrace();
}
}
if (conn != null){
Systemoutprintln("数据库连接成功!!");
}
return conn;
}
public static boolean closeConnection() {// 关闭数据库连接的方法
boolean isClosed = true;
Connection conn = threadLocalget();// 从线程中获得数据库连接
threadLocalset(null);// 清空线程中的数据库连接
if (conn != null) {// 数据库连接可用
try {
connclose();// 关闭数据库连接
} catch (SQLException e) {
isClosed = false;
eprintStackTrace();
}
}
if (conn == null){
Systemoutprintln("断开连接成功!!");
}
else {
Systemoutprintln("失败!!");
}
return isClosed;
}
}
关键步骤:
1new ==> File ==> dbsql如下图:
2找
Date Source Explorer
Window ==> Show View ==> Others==> Data Management==> Date Source Explorer
双击
3New选择自己连接的数据库
双击,没显示值,点击右边那个加号
4 选中数据库版本(自己的是哪个版本就选哪个)
5移除自带的jar包,然后添加自带的jar包
填写相关信息
确定之后
6 最后eclipse中查看数据库
7 已经连接上,可以使用SQL语句了
选中sql语句右击executeAll,此时sql语句被运行
我的环境:MySQL:mysql-essential-5151-win32
jdbc驱动:我已经上传到csdn上一个:>
以上就是关于eclipse的sqlite数据库用sqlitemanage全部的内容,包括:eclipse的sqlite数据库用sqlitemanage、在eclipse中开发java程序怎么用数据库、如何使用eclipse连接mysql数据库等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)